A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 58790 and ZIP Code 58795: population, income, housing, and more.

ZIP 58790 and ZIP 58795 are ZIP Code areas in North Dakota.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 58790 has the higher population (1,500 vs 256 in ZIP 58795). ZIP 58795 has the higher median household income ($99,643 vs $81,563 in ZIP 58790). ZIP 58790 has the higher median home value ($232,500 vs $132,100 in ZIP 58795).
